Black Dyke duo make call for horns and baritones

How would you like to join Helen Varley and Katrina Marzella for a spotlight morning of horn and baritone playing at the forthcoming Black Dyke Festival in Leeds?

  Katrina Marzella and Helen Varley will lead the horn and baritone spotlight day

This year the newly crowned Yorkshire Regional Champion Black Dyke will showcase a special 'Tenor Horn & Baritone Spotlight' event at their annual Festival at Leeds Town Hall on Sunday 4th June.

Family focus

Led by Black Dyke stars Helen Varley and Katrina Marzella, the workshop, which will feature exciting ensemble activities and interactive participation suitable for all family members, will run from 10.00am — 12 noon.

It will be followed by the opportunity to participate in the Gala Concert with Black Dyke Band and guests in the afternoon.

Lots to learn

Katrina told 4BR: "Helen and I are really looking forward to hosting the horn and baritone workshop. It's something we have wanted to do for a long time, as we think both horn 'family' members have a lot to learn from each other.

We have some great activities for the participants and have already had fantastic interest with some enthusiasts travelling from as far afield as the USA!"

Meanwhile, Helen added: "Places are limited however, so please do get in touch quickly if you would like to take part and enjoy some great music making together with us."

Register

The cost for the full day is just £5. All you need to do to register is send an e-mail to Helen Varley at HLVarley@gmail.com and register your name, instrument (tenor horn or baritone), standard, band, e-mail address and phone number.

Tickets are also on sale for the gala concert event in the afternoon, available from Leeds Town Hall Box Office on 0113 224 3801.
